Psalm 18:33 says,

"He makes my feet like the feet of a deer; he causes me to stand on the heights." Psalm 18:33.

This verse gives us a lot of comfort and inspiration for our faith. It is praise for the Lord and gives him credit for our confidence. It says He is the one who lifts us up.

Free Isaiah 26:3 Print and Color Page, You Keep Him in Perfect Peace Bible Veres.

This print and color page features a beautiful verse of comfort from Isaiah. It assures us that we will find peace if we focus on God. We are encouraged when we keep our minds on the Lord. This verse states that God keeps us in peace, which implies that God is the source of our peace. It is about focusing and keeping our thoughts on Him. When we think about him, we will begin to trust him more.

Free Hebrews 4:16 Print and Color Page, ...Let us approach God's Throne... Bible verse

Here is a print and color Bible verse that is a favorite from the book of Hebrews. It teaches us that we can be bold and confident in our prayer and that God will answer with grace when we pray.  I think the keyword is grace. It does not guarantee that we will escape trouble (though God may outright deliver us), but we may be enabled to endure and grow through our troubles.
